The film explores the life and accomplishments of David John Moore Cornwell, who is more known by his pen name, John le Carré. The narrative of the documentary spans six decades, covering Cornwell’s life in its entirety. As the author gives his last and most personal interview, the scenes often shift to rare archival footage and fascinating stories of the past.

The cast includes Jake Dove as Teenage David Cornwell, Charlotte Hamblin as Olive Cornwell, Garry Cooper as Ronnie Cornwell, Simon Harrison as Kim Philby, Arlo Dodgson as Young David Cornwell, Mike Noble by Adult David Cornwell, and more.
